Submission from: (NULL) (130.76.64.16) I have used fvwm2 for years with Red Hat Linux (going back to Red Hat 4.0). I recently upgraded to 8.0 and now when X windows I generate using the Xlib are covered, they are black when uncovered. I was under the assumption that fvwm2 handled this. Is that true? How can I fix this. My displays are real time image displays and I don't want to regenerate. What happened? Sorry, this is probably not a bug, but I need help!
